Firm hired to review Jersey City's 911 system has ties to police brass

Jersey City is wrapping up a $38,000 review of its police and fire dispatch services, a longtime goal of Public Safety Director James Shea that is being conducted by a firm with ties to the man who got Shea his current job.

Princeton-based IXP Corp. is performing the study, which Shea has said will give him an idea of how efficient the city's 911 system is. The company's senior vice president is Adam Safir, son of Howard Safir, a former New York Police Department commissioner who led the search to hire Shea in 2013.
